On the sweeper loop in `orphan_sweeper.rs`: the logic looks right, but I'm concerned about the interaction between the scan interval and the grace period. If a resource is created just before a scan, the current code could flag it as orphaned before its owner record replicates from the Brindlefork region. I'd suggest making the grace period strictly longer than worst-case replication lag and documenting that invariant. For reference, here's what I'd propose as defaults.

tuning table, yajog-yahof:
BUDGETS = {
    "lamvan": 303,
    "wenox": 460,
    "fenvan": 525,
}

Subject: On-call primer — Lumiere seat-map renderer

Hi, and welcome to the rotation! The renderer draws live seat availability for the Calloway Theatre booking flow. Most pages you'll get are stale-cache alerts; the fix is usually flushing the seat-state cache, not restarting the service. Restarts drop active holds, so treat them as a last resort and loop in a senior first. The full escalation guide and dashboards are on the internal page:

runbook for badug-kadup: https://confluence.zemvarlabs.internal/projects/browse/display/projects/bd1b

Finance Review Summary — Harthaven Pilot Programme

Welcome aboard. Quick picture on churn: the pilot lost 14% of enrolled customers in the first two quarters, mostly in month three when the intro discount lapsed. Exit surveys point to pricing shock rather than product issues. Retention offers trialled in two districts cut churn roughly in half, at a modest margin cost. Full workbook is in the shared drive. The confidential plan going forward is below.

internal memo for bahap-yagug: Headcount on the Ulaix team goes from 3 to 100 by the end of January. Gross margin on Ulaix came in at 10 percent against a plan of 15 percent.

# Quellbird Environments

Quellbird is our on-call alert deduplicator — it collapses repeated pages into one grouped alert so nobody gets paged forty times for the same flapping host. Support folks: you'll mostly touch staging and prod. Staging dedupes against a synthetic alert stream, so don't panic if it looks noisy. Prod uses a 5-minute grouping window; staging uses 1 minute, which trips people up constantly. If a customer asks why alerts grouped oddly, check the environment first. Prod currently runs with these values.

service settings:
[casax]
port = 6379
team = rusir
host = casax.zemvarhq.corp
region = outer-4
access_code = ac_9808ce
timeout_ms = 1500